CENTURY AEROSPACE SWITCHES TO TWIN-ENGINE CONFIGURATION FOR NEW JET
Century Aerospace Corp., which had been developing a single-engine, entry-level business jet, has reconfigured the aircraft to a twin-engine design to take advantage of new Williams International turbofans.
